Temecula Valley Charter School Back to Search Temecula Valley Charter School Categories Non-Profits Education | Children's Services (951) 294-6775 Send Email www.tvcscougars.com Share × Print Email Facebook LinkedIn X Pinterest Powered By GrowthZone